Output 58590a822a97b7ef9a181fcc7d8c833358558a8e647ab6670804e94707796be3:41

value
9565938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e68fe3e3b909c11bdc10e39983ddb91abe37b491642d46cdb2014e1fdfedfbbd
address
bc1pu6878caep8q3hhqsuwvc8hder2lr0dy3vsk5dndjq98plhldlw7stwztek
transaction
58590a822a97b7ef9a181fcc7d8c833358558a8e647ab6670804e94707796be3